New tool cuts hospital readmissions by helping nurses see who needs help first

NCT ID NCT04136951

Summary

This study tested a computer tool called PREVENT, designed to help homecare nurses decide which patients need their first visit most urgently after leaving the hospital. It involved nearly 2,000 patients with conditions like heart failure and diabetes. The goal was to see if using the tool to schedule visits faster for high-risk patients could prevent them from being readmitted to the hospital.
